Transaction 12a75362b5397ef3de1fe44befc524583955960dc0000cb6656eb5287f6a7def

1 Input
2 Outputs
  • 12a75362b5397ef3de1fe44befc524583955960dc0000cb6656eb5287f6a7def:0
  • value  249548
    address  39KxKMdYLAi5cXNVs1dm92QGAin88MyhEX
  • 12a75362b5397ef3de1fe44befc524583955960dc0000cb6656eb5287f6a7def:1
  • value  769838
    address  174LuiQnHtipRqmP4VuLV2eWAqnwL4v5sV